Women's Lacrosse Falls to Mount Olive in Home Finale

ROME- The Shorter Women's Lacrosse team fell to Mount Olive in their home finale Saturday afternoon, suffering a 24-7 defeat. The loss drops the Hawks to 3-11 and 3-5 in conference. 


The Hawks battled with the Trojans early on, taking a 2-1 lead with goals from Kayla Roscoe and Cassidy Jones. The Trojans fired back with a goal before Jones answered with one to regain the lead. Mount Olive closed the opening frame to take the 4-3 lead after one. 


The visitors managed to break open the lead with six unanswered goals to begin the second quarter before Cassidy Jones found the net to end the run. Goals from Kaitlyn Dwyer-Peppers and Maggie Wallace helped the Hawks cut the deficit to five to close the second quarter as they entered halftime behind 11-6. 


Mount Olive controlled the game the rest of the way, outscoring Shorter 13-1 in the second half. Shyla Araujo scored the final goal for the Hawks late in the period. Shorter continued to battle all the way through, but fell in a 24-7 defeat. 


UP NEXT
The Hawks will close their regular season on Thursday as they travel to Emmanuel for the season finale.
